What is Black Tea?


Black tea is a type of tea that undergoes complete oxidation, resulting in its dark color, robust flavor, and strong aroma. It is made from the leaves of the Camellia sinensis plant, just like other types of tea such as green tea and oolong tea. However, the difference lies in the processing methods and the level of oxidation.


The Process of Black Tea Production


Black tea production involves several key steps to transform freshly plucked tea leaves into the final product. Here is an overview of the typical process:


  1. Withering: The freshly harvested tea leaves are spread out to wither, allowing them to lose moisture and become pliable. This step helps prepare the leaves for the next stage of processing.
  2. Rolling: The withered leaves are carefully rolled to break down the leaf cells and release the enzymes responsible for oxidation. Rolling also helps shape the leaves and enhance their flavor.
  3. Oxidation: The rolled leaves are spread out in a controlled environment to undergo oxidation. This process allows the enzymes to react with the oxygen in the air, leading to chemical changes that result in the characteristic dark color and flavor of black tea.
  4. Firing: The oxidized leaves are subjected to high temperatures to halt the oxidation process and remove any remaining moisture. Firing helps preserve the flavor, aroma, and quality of the tea.
  5. Sorting and Grading: The fired leaves are sorted and graded based on their size, color, and quality. This classification ensures that each batch of tea meets specific standards and allows for consistency in flavor and appearance.
  6. Packaging: The sorted black tea leaves are carefully packaged to preserve their freshness, aroma, and flavor. They are packaged as loose leaf tea or used in tea bags, ready to be enjoyed by tea lovers around the world.

FAQs: Frequently Asked Questions


  1. Is black tea the most popular type of tea worldwide?
    Yes, black tea is one of the most widely consumed types of tea globally, appreciated for its robust flavor and versatility.
  2. Are all black teas the same in terms of taste and aroma?
    No, black teas can vary in flavor and aroma based on factors such as the tea plant varietal, growing region, processing methods, and more.
